Austin Theory Opens Up About Failed WWE Money In The Bank Cash-In

Austin Theory has looked back on the night when he made history in all the wrong ways with his Money in the Bank cash-in.

Theory captured the briefcase in 2022 after being added to the match on short notice. With Theory being aligned with Vince McMahon at this point as a potential protege, the former United States Champion looked set to be featured more prominently on TV.

However, during the time when Theory had the briefcase, Roman Reigns was in the middle of his historic 1,316-day reign as Undisputed Champion. With Reigns having held the title for so long, few expected Theory to be the one to dethrone The Tribal Chief.

With this in mind, many expected there to be a failed cash-in from Theory. However, Theory instead chose to cash in his opportunity on US Champion Seth Rollins. Despite having the advantage, Theory still lost the match and squandered his opportunity.

“It Sucked”: Austin Theory On Failed Money In The Bank Cash-In

Appearing on Logan Paul’s Impaulsive podcast, the former Tag Team Champion recalled that night. Theory stated that there was a good build-up to the moment, but wished that they could have done more:

“Yes. I’m gonna go run the play always if we really need it to be this way. I think for me I felt like, even with the moment I had with Roman, it was, I believe, at Barclays Center; he hit me with the ‘your daddy’s not here anymore’. In that moment I wanted to say the same thing to him, because in a way it’s like he’s a Vince guy as well. Not in a way he was,” Theory said.

“I felt like there could have been a moment; I knew I wasn’t gonna get the title off Roman, but even just building it to seem like ‘oh, here we go’. I can lose to him, whatever, but just give it more of a payoff, because it felt cool man; I did a lot of cool things with it.

Theory also noted that he has the dented briefcase, which was damaged after he was attacked by Brock Lesnar:

“It’s funny how I have it in my office hanging, and it’s real dented, and people see it and go ‘You murdered people with that huh?’ I’m like, ‘No, Brock Lesnar murdered me with it, and it sucked,’”

Theory recently held the World Tag Team Championships alongside Bron Breakker, but lost the titles to The Street Profits on the June 22 WWE Raw. The Vision will receive their rematch against The Profits on the next episode of the show.
